If you are planning a quick excursion from Grand Prairie to Weatherford, you are looking at a straightforward 48.5-mile journey across the Texas Great Plains. Expect to spend about 1 hour and 2 minutes behind the wheel, making this an ideal day trip that requires no overnight stay. You will primarily navigate via the Tom Landry Freeway, the West Freeway, and I-20, keeping your travel time efficient. With fuel costs estimated at around $7, it is a budget-friendly route for a weekend escape or a quick change of scenery. Since both locations reside within the same region, you will experience a consistent landscape throughout the drive. This trip is perfect for those who prioritize a direct, no-fuss connection between these two Texas hubs.

This 48.5-mile route is a quintessential highway-focused drive, with 81% of your time spent on major thoroughfares. You will quickly settle into a rhythm on the Tom Landry Freeway, which features the longest uninterrupted stretch of the trip at 17 miles. The experience is defined by high-speed interstate travel rather than winding backroads, keeping the drive functional and predictable. As you transition between the Tom Landry Freeway, West Freeway, and I-20, the road maintains a steady pace that allows for consistent progress. Prepare for a standard interstate experience that keeps you moving toward your destination without the complexities of technical local navigation.
This is a straightforward highway drive that stays mostly on Tom Landry Freeway and West Freeway. This route has several spots where lane changes, forks, or exits need your full attention. The trickiest moment comes early in the drive near Northeast 5th Street.

Grand Prairie is a city in the Prairies and Lakes region of Texas.
Weatherford is a city in the Cross Timbers region of Texas. It is the county seat of Parker County.
